Ametros Expands Leadership Team to Enhance Member Experience

WHAT'S THE STORY?

What's Happening?

Ametros, a leader in professional administration of medical insurance claims settlements, has announced the expansion of its leadership team with the appointment of Hollie Lamboy as Vice President of Member Experience and Lena Lini as Vice President of Member Operations. These new roles are part of Ametros' strategy to enhance the experience for members navigating post-settlement medical care. Lamboy brings over 20 years of experience in pharmacy benefits and workers' compensation, focusing on product development and customer service. Lini, with a background in managed care and cost containment, will oversee operational excellence and service delivery.
